1 Person Injured In A Pedestrian Accident In Whatcom County (Whatcom County, WA)

According to the Whatcom County Sheriff’s deputies, a pedestrian accident was reported on Thursday. 

The officials stated that a single vehicle was involved in the crash that happened at the northern intersection of Portal Way and Loomis Trail Road. 

According to the officials, a truck driver was heading southbound when a male pedestrian wearing dark clothes was struck. The area was dimly lit which disabled the driver to notice the man. 

The Washington State Patrol declared the man dead at the scene. 

The identity of the deceased victim was not provided. 

The officials reported that the driver of the truck was not impaired at the time of the crash. 

No additional information regarding the fatal crash was provided by the WSP.
